Sumita, a 29-year-old woman from Darjeeling district, West Bengal, lives with her family, including her two school-aged children. Her husband is a hardworking farmer who grows various crops throughout the year, striving to provide a better life for his family. He owns a piece of land that he obtained through great effort. Sumita manages the household chores and assists her husband in the fields with cleaning, pruning, and harvesting crops. Farming is their sole source of income.
Currently, the couple plans to cultivate cabbages, a staple food in West Bengal with high local demand, but they lack the necessary funds. To support this, Sumita is seeking a loan of 80,000 INR from WeGrow, a Milaap field partner. She formed a group with two women from similar backgrounds who are facing financial challenges. Together, they are requesting financial assistance to purchase seeds, organic fertilizer, and other essential supplies for cultivation, which are otherwise unaffordable due to high costs.
